2022 Winners
The Tyers Art Festival Features regional artists
from across Victoria.
We're pleased to showcase the winners from the 2022 Tyers Art Festival
Time to Reflect by Kathy Leek (Pastel)
Tyers Award - Best Exhibit (Other than Designer Craft)
Winter Night by Jo Gellion
Best Exhibit (Oil)
A Bag of Apple by Glenn Hoyle
Best Exhibit (Acrylic)
Storm Damage by Cynthia Boyle
Best Exhibit (Watercolour)
Sour by Lingdejun Chen
Best Exhibit (Mixed Media)
Protea by Joanne Gellion
Best Exhibit (Pastel)
The Green Man by Cynthia Boyle
Best Exhibit (Drawing - pencil)
Who Me by Julie Gilbert
Best Exhibit (Portrait Photography)
Little Skipper, Little Flower by Sandy Thomson
Best Exhibit (Landscape Photography)
Always Better with Butter by Barbara Jones
Hanger's Choice
Skullscrew by Rachel Grant
Best Exhibit (Designer Craft Metalwork)
Arrogant Bird by Jacqueline Hume
Best Exhibit (Designer Craft Other)
Bella by Lara Healey
Achievement Award (Under 18)
Snow Leopard by Nathan Markovich
Drawing Award (Under 18)
After the Rain by Emily Kanavan
Traralgon District & Society Award (Under 18)
Save the Turtles by Indyanna Hunt
Under 18 Artist Award
Lighthouse by Marley Neave
Melrossa Art Studio Scholarship
Save the Turtles by Indyanna Hunt
